A remortgage valuation is when a lender checks how much your property is worth before giving you a new mortgage. It’s meant to confirm that the property’s current value is enough to secure the loan if you can’t pay it.

If your remortgage application is not approved, you might need to stay with your current lender and your existing mortgage terms. If you’d still like to remortgage, you can address the issues identified by the valuation report and reapply later. You can also look for other lenders who might have different criteria for loan approvals.

The lender will usually arrange for a valuation as part of the remortgage process. However, doing your own research can still be helpful. It gives you a good idea of your property’s value, helping you understand if the lender’s valuation is fair.
